Vue で静的 jQuery が導入された場合のエラーを解決する方法
Web アプリケーションを開発するとき、ページの操作や機能を実現するために Vue フレームワークと jQuery ライブラリを使用することがよくあります。ただし、Vue プロジェクトに jQuery を導入すると、いくつかのエラーが発生し、プロジェクトが正常に実行されなくなることがあります。この記事では、Vue で静的 jQuery が導入された場合のエラーの解決方法と具体的なコード例を紹介します。
まず、プロジェクトに jQuery をインストールする必要があります。 jQuery は npm 経由でインストールできます。コマンドは次のとおりです。
npm install jquery --save
Vue コンポーネントへの jQuery の導入には、通常 2 つの方法があります。 :
方法 1: import メソッドを使用して導入します。
jQuery を使用する必要があるコンポーネントでは、import ステートメントを使用して jQuery を導入できます。
import $ from 'jquery';
方法 2:グローバル インポートを使用する
プロジェクトの main.js ファイルで、グローバル インポート メソッドを使用して jQuery を導入できます。コードは次のとおりです:
import Vue from 'vue'; import $ from 'jquery'; Vue.prototype.$ = $;
jQuery を導入した後、エラー報告の問題が発生することがあります。一般的なエラー報告の問題は、「$ が定義されていません」です。これは jQuery と Vue の導入順序に起因するもので、解決するには Vue より先に jQuery を導入します。
Vueコンポーネントでは、作成したフック関数にjQueryを導入することで問題を解決できますサンプルコードは以下の通りです:
export default { created() { import('jquery').then($ => { this.$ = $; }); }, // 其他代码 }
上記はVue時のエラーを解決する方法です静的 jQuery を紹介し、具体的なコード例を示します。お役に立てれば。
以上がVue に静的 jQuery を導入する際のエラーを解決する方法の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。